Brady’s Praise for Ridge’s Flag Football Titans

Tom Brady took to social media to celebrate the Seminole Ridge High School flag football team, whose recent state championship has cemented its place among the nation’s elite.

The Raiders captured their second straight Class 3A state title, finishing the season with a 20‑2 record and earning the top national ranking in the sport.

In a video message posted on his personal accounts, Brady praised the players and coaches, saying the program’s relentless drive sets a benchmark for high school athletics.

He went on to challenge the squad to chase a historic three‑peat, urging them to make 2027 the year they add a third consecutive crown to their résumé.

The quarterback’s own career, decorated with seven Super Bowl rings, never produced a three‑peat at the professional level, making his wish for the young athletes all the more poignant.

Local officials and parents alike have hailed the team’s achievement as a boost for the community, highlighting the school’s growing reputation in youth sports.
